Python 3.6.0-Windows+NumPy+Matplotlib
1、下载Python3.6.0
https://www.python.org/downloads/
正常安装 并配置环境变量
2、运行安装 pip
测试
3、下载安装Numpy Matplotlib
寻找对应版本文件进行下载
http://www.lfd.uci.edu/~gohlke/pythonlibs/#scipy
http://www.lfd.uci.edu/~gohlke/pythonlibs/#numpy
http://www.lfd.uci.edu/~gohlke/pythonlibs/#matplotlib
http://www.lfd.uci.edu/~gohlke/pythonlibs/#scikit-learn
pip install XXX.whl进行安装
4、测试 使用自带IDLE
测试代码来源:http://blog.csdn.net/ali197294332/article/details/51694141
# -*- coding:utf-8 -*- import numpy as np import matplotlib.mlab as mlab import matplotlib.pyplot as plt mu = 100 # 正态分布的均值 sigma = 15 # 标准差 x = mu + sigma * np.random.randn(10000)#在均值周围产生符合正态分布的x值 num_bins = 50 n, bins, patches = plt.hist(x, num_bins, normed=1, facecolor='green', alpha=0.5) #直方图函数,x为x轴的值,normed=1表示为概率密度,即和为一,绿色方块,色深参数0.5.返回n个概率,直方块左边线的x值,及各个方块对象 y = mlab.normpdf(bins, mu, sigma)#画一条逼近的曲线 plt.plot(bins, y, 'r--') plt.xlabel('Smarts') plt.ylabel('Probability') plt.title(r'Histogram of IQ: $\mu=100$, $\sigma=15$')#中文标题 u'xxx' plt.subplots_adjust(left=0.15)#左边距 plt.show()
结果
PS:
安装2.7.13时 没有默认的easy_install.exe 需要进行下载
下载setuptools进行:https://pypi.python.org/pypi/setuptools
2、解压后进行安装
完成安装后即可